I have seen discussions about high RF levels damaging the TinySA even when it is turned OFF. So I have to wonder when the TinySA is in shipment if it is being subjected to RF levels that could destroy it. For instance, X-Ray inspection of parcels. Is there a danger of this kind of damage during shipment?
